These included a remake of the classic " Silent Hill 2," a "deep psychological horror" game known as " Silent Hill: Townfall," and the mysterious " Silent Hill f." In addition to these games, an exciting interactive experience called " Silent Hill: Ascension" was revealed, along with a new movie, "Return to Silent Hill." "Guillermo Del Toro, who gave me my first movie, called me up and said, 'Hey, there's a guy named Hideo Kojima, he's gonna call you, just say yes.' And I go, 'What do you mean just say yes?' He goes, 'Stop being an asshole, just say yes.' Then I was in San Diego and Hideo came with a big group of people, he's from Tokyo, and he showed me what he was working on on a game called Silent Hill.
